User redirection via unvalidated page parameter
Published Mar 20, 2023 · Updated Feb 26, 2025
Open redirect in Rapid7 Nexpose 6.6.178 and earlier allows remote attackers to redirect users to an attacker-chosen site. The data/console/redirect component accepts the page parameter as a redirect destination without restricting it to trusted URLs. Exploitation requires a user to follow a crafted request, after which the console sends the browser to the supplied site; no direct console data access is reported.
